Quick one on the Marbleforge static-analysis baseline: if your branch suddenly flags a hundred pre-existing issues, the baseline file probably drifted. Regenerate it with the `refresh-baseline` task on a clean checkout of main, not your feature branch, or you'll bake your own warnings in. Commit the regenerated file by itself so review stays sane. The build token from the regeneration run should appear right below this paragraph.

build token for kagaf-hahof: htk14_9d3d4d26d7d8de

### Account Recovery — Crumbline Cutoff Service

Quick note for whoever inherits this: the order-cutoff rule for Marloway Bakery locks next-day orders at 6 p.m. sharp, and the admin account that tunes it gets auto-disabled after three failed logins. Happens more than you'd think. To recover, hit the reset endpoint from an internal box and confirm the cutoff config checksum. The reset prompt will ask for the phrase below.

vault phrase of hawep-badup = sorwyn-briir-eliion-julox-novmir-rusir-weniel-gorvan-oliael-gileth-kelius-zorox-fraion-quenix

Subject: SDK parity check before your first shift

Welcome to on-call for Lanternkit. Quick context: the Swift and Kotlin SDKs are supposed to ship identical feature sets, but the Kotlin side lags by one release right now. Offline caching and the new retry policy exist only in Swift. If a ticket mentions behavior differing between platforms, check the parity matrix first — don't assume a bug. We update it every release cut. The matrix and known gaps are tracked on the internal page here:

runbook for kawef-hahif: https://jira.lumicsys.internal/projects/browse/display/c08d703c

- [ ] Step 7: Archive cold storage buckets (Glacierline tier). Confirm both ceremony witnesses are present, verify bucket manifests match the Oxbow ledger, then seal the archive key shares. Plugin authors may observe but not handle shares. Once sealed, the archive index itself is encrypted and can only be reopened with the passphrase below.

vault phrase of badup-hahig = tamael-aldael-kelmir-istael-fenok-istwyn-tamius-jorath-oliion